City Overview
Bristol is located at the confluence of the Pemigewasset River and Newfound Lake, making it a prime spot for individuals who appreciate the tranquil beauty of New England's lakes and mountains. This quaint town is steeped in history, with roots dating back to the early 18th century. Today, it is recognized for its vibrant community, which is dedicated to preserving the town’s rich heritage while fostering growth and development.

Tourism Appeal
Bristol is a hidden gem for tourists seeking an authentic New England experience. The town acts as a gateway to Newfound Lake, one of the cleanest lakes in the state, offering swimming, fishing, and boating activities during the warmer months. The lake is surrounded by stunning forests and trails, perfect for hiking and exploring.
In addition to the lake, visitors can explore the Bristol Historical Society, which provides insights into the town's past and showcases artifacts that tell the story of Bristol’s development. For those looking for adventure, the nearby Cardigan Mountain State Park offers breathtaking views and trails for all skill levels.
Bristol also hosts an array of annual events that attract visitors from near and far. The Bristol Old Home Day, celebrated in August, is a highlight of the summer, featuring parades, local vendors, and family-friendly activities that foster community spirit and connection.
